#ea1fad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ea1fad is composed of 91.8% red, 12.2%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.8% magenta, 26.1%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 318 degrees, a saturation of 82.9% and a lightness of 52%. #ea1fad color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3eff with #d5005b.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

Shades and Tints of #ea1fad
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090107 is the darkest color, while #fef6f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#ea1fad
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c7d87 is the less saturated color, while #fd0cb5 is the most saturated one.
